The article examines a differentiated-products duopoly model where the firms make entry decisions to two markets and … then choose prices. The effects of product differentiation and entry costs are analyzed in two games: with and without … price discrimination between the markets. Allowing price discrimination encourages more entry and tends to reduce prices and …
